The Registered Nurse provides comprehensive nursing care through physical and mental assessments, laboratory testing, and implementing treatment plans, including performing crisis intervention. Responsibilities also involve maintaining a safe therapeutic environment, leading the shift team, and ensuring quality patient care delivery.
Candidates must possess an Associate's degree in nursing from an accredited program, a current Registered Nurse license in the state of employment, and certifications in CPR and hospital-selected de-escalation techniques. Preferred experience includes at least one year in a behavioral healthcare setting.
